NT Areal, Basel, CH<br />

The NT Areal (or Erlenmatt), in a part of Basel which <strong>the</strong> residents call “Kleinbasel”, is an area that was<br />

formerly used as a merchandise hub, and 10 years out of service, is now <strong>the</strong> subject of development by <strong>the</strong><br />

city and private investors that will take place over <strong>the</strong> next 20 years.<br />

The real estate company, Vivico <strong>Re</strong>al Esate GmbH - a part of <strong>the</strong> german federal train company - has <strong>the</strong><br />

task to take over <strong>the</strong> area and plan a “mixed” program neighborhood development, including 700 new apartmets.<br />

This process is to be implemented slowly, with a first project of 240 apartments.<br />

Until that time,<strong>the</strong> city of Basel has decided - with city planners and researchers of <strong>the</strong> area - to create a<br />

“temporary use” and experimental zone, to retain vitality and awareness of <strong>the</strong> areal. The development<br />

group has decided to open <strong>the</strong> field of use, including <strong>the</strong> large historical structure in <strong>the</strong> center of <strong>the</strong> areal<br />

as a congress center on various occasions during <strong>the</strong> year.<br />

On <strong>the</strong> grounds of <strong>the</strong> NT Areal (which stands for “non-territorial”), cultural, sport, and commercial activity<br />

have already begun to take place, such as green ways for hikers, a dirt-bike jump for those daring, a climing<br />

wall, a night club/bar, a Sunday marketplace, and areas left open for experimentation such as <strong>the</strong> “Karawanserei”<br />

- in which structures are quickly built and house various activities that allow also for an unlimited<br />

time of living arangements.<br />

In short, <strong>the</strong> city is making use of a zone under planning as an expression of <strong>the</strong> city and its experimental<br />

and creative abilities, a quality that is well among <strong>the</strong> <strong>Swiss</strong> and respected as part of <strong>the</strong> culture.<br />
